Eisley Heads Back on the Road With Headlining Tour Band Returns to the Studio to Record New Album This Spring NEW YORK, NY--(MARKET WIRE)--Feb 14, 2006 -- Reprise Records' Eisley are heading back on
the road for a two-month headlining tour of North America.
After the tour,
the band is scheduled to return to the studio to record
the highly
anticipated follow-up to their well-received album "Room
Noises." The band
will be previewing new songs during their live set on this
tour. Audiences far and wide have come to love the dreamy, ethereal indie pop sound of Eisley. Their signature harmonies are soothing and permeating leaving fans thirsting for more. The Texas-based quintet is comprised of four brothers and sisters in Chauntelle, Sherri, Weston, and Stacy DuPree, plus their cousin and most recent addition Garron DuPree. The group has carved out an incredible following over the past few years, while also garnering critical media attention. In 2005, immediately following the release of "Room Noises," Eisley was hailed as Blender's "Band To Watch," and won Yahoo!'s "Who's Next" artist, a distinction determined entirely by fans. They were also nominated for an MTVu Woodie award, which honors the best in music amongst college students. Subsequently, the band's larger-than-life energy earned them tours with Brand New, Coldplay, and Switchfoot, giving them a platform for their own headlining tour last year, which was sold out.
